The history of Mumbai—Lalbaug in Parel goes back again towards the 1900s, when the complete location was dominated by over a hundred textile mills. It is actually thanks to these mills, this space was regionally generally known as Girangaon or even the ‘village of mills’.

Tassa is definitely an Indo-Caribbean musical genre well-liked in Trinidad and Tobago characterized by a four-part ensemble comprising 4 devices: two modest kettledrums identified as “tassa,” a double-headed bass drum identified as dhol or simply “bass,” and jhal, a list of hand cymbals. The reason for that bend stick is due to goat skin. This is often slim like 80-100gsm paper, Hence the adhere must be bent to avoid piercing the skin. The bass adhere or Dagga may be the thicker of The 2 and is also bent within an eighth- or quarter-circular arc on the tip that strikes the instrument.[two] The other stick, known as the teeli, is far thinner and versatile and used to Engage in the upper note conclude of the instrument.[3]

Over time, Mumbai’s Ganesh Chaturthi celebrations experienced greater in dimensions and scale, with pandals competing with one another to put up the largest, grandest show. For Lalbaugcha Raja, famed as the Navasacha Ganpati or maybe the desire-fulfilling Ganesha, it meant longer serpentine queues—people today waited in line for over 48 several hours in a very queue that was several kilometres long, for just a glimpse of their beloved Ganpati.
